Requirements for 100-Gb/s Metro Networks

TL;DR: In this paper, a combined DPSK and 3-ASK modulation format for 100-Gb/s optical transport is reported as realizable at relatively low cost with currently available components, and it is shown that metro and regional network transmission requirements are met.
